How they compare

Spain currently reports 90.48 current US$ against 74.75 current US$ in Albania, a difference of 15.73 current US$.

That makes Spain's figure about 1.2 times Albania's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 25 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Spain ahead.

Albania ranks 82nd and Spain ranks 80th of 116 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Albania averaged higher in 1 and Spain in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Albania Spain Difference Ahead
1990s 10.15 current US$ 48.98 current US$ 38.83 current US$ Spain
2000s 62.62 current US$ 16.73 current US$ 45.89 current US$ Albania
2010s 97.11 current US$ 142.03 current US$ 44.92 current US$ Spain
2020s 74.75 current US$ 90.48 current US$ 15.73 current US$ Spain

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
